Increase Fertility with Acupuncture. There are many reasons why couples have difficulty conceiving - irregular menstruation, hormone imbalance, cold uterus, and low sperm count to name a few. Whatever the reason infertility can be a major cause of stress and hopelessness in otherwise healthy couples. Acupuncture combined with herbal medicine has been used for centuries to treat the causes of infertility. Acupuncture in particular has been known to dramatically increase fertility by regulating the menstrual cycle in females and invigorating and increasing sperm count in males. A German Study conducted in 2002 used two groups of women experiencing fertility difficulties, to determine the effects of acupuncture on IVF treatments. In the first group, acupuncture treatments were carried out 25 minutes before embryo transfer and 25 minutes after the embryo was inserted into the uterus. In the second group, no acupuncture treatments were given. Study findings showed a successful pregnancy rate of 42.5% in the first group of women compared to 26.3% in the second group that had no acupuncture treatments. This highlighted a significant difference of 16.2% between the two groups of women. In each Care Cure clinic, we look for the underlying problem of disharmony which is preventing conception. Treatments for fertility difficulties and male impotency usually include acupuncture, acupressure, moxibustion and herbal medicines.

Electro-acupuncture is the term used to refer to the application of a pulsating electrical current to acupuncture needles, or even without needles, to acupuncture points on the body. This Oriental medicine technique was developed in China in the 1930's, and though it is a fairly recent development in the ancient method of acupuncture, the idea behind it corresponds directly with long-held beliefs. Acupuncture operates on the idea that a person's qi, or life force, runs through body along certain meridians, and that specific points on the body correspond with these meridians. When these points are ‘activated' or stimulated by touch, specific complaints of chronic pain or illnesses can be alleviated. Using a gentle electrical current in conjunction with, or instead of, acupuncture needles, is an alternative way to stimulate the point and enhance the qi.

Electroacupuncture is quite similar to traditional acupuncture in that the same points are stimulated during treatment. As with traditional acupuncture, needles are inserted on specific points along the body. The needles are then attached to a device that generates continuous electric pulses using small clips. These devices are used to adjust the frequency and intensity of the impulse being delivered, depending on the condition being treated. Electroacupuncture uses two needles at a time so that the impulses can pass from one needle to the other. Several pairs of needles can be stimulated simultaneously, usually for no more than 30 minutes at a time. Electro-acupuncture is particularly good for pain relief and tension and I often use this treatment for musculo skeletal conditions.
